As a Senior Actuarial Analyst, you will lead pricing initiatives and collaborate with business partners to understand their needs. You will lead complex projects to deliver unique solutions to ensure the profitability of our auto portfolio.
How you will create impact :
- Developing rate change projects (rate level or segmentation) and various advanced analytical models aligned with corporate strategies.
- Preparing of rate filings and negotiating with regulators to support proposed changes.
- Working efficiently with advanced modeling software, various data sources and programming languages to contribute to strategic objectives.
- Communicating basic actuarial concepts within the department both verbally and in writing, and prepare official communication within the department.
- Upholding professional ethics, values, policies and procedures that support the company’s and profession’s standards.
- Utilizing and developing Actuarial Knowledge and experience gained through research and development initiatives as well as education learning.
- Training and mentoring of team.
